What the filing says
On May 14, 2026, Orphai Therapeutics (Customer) entered a License and Supply Agreement with Plastiape S.p.A. (Supplier, Italy) for inhalation devices. Key terms: (1) Supplier manufactures devices; Customer integrates into finished drug-device combination products. (2) Exclusivity granted for specified molecules/APIs during stated term, contingent on minimum purchase quantities; failure to meet minimums allows cure via payment of redacted Exclusivity Fee or unspecified alternative. (3) Supplier retains all IP; Customer gets limited right of reference for regulatory filings only. (4) Price, payment terms, forecasts, and operational details redacted. (5) Term: initial period [redacted] then indefinite; Supplier can terminate post-initial term on [redacted] notice; Customer can terminate anytime on [redacted] notice. (6) Liability capped at [redacted]; exclusivity disputes subject to injunctive relief. Schedules 1–4 (specifications, regulatory status, exclusivity details, pricing, commercial terms) heavily redacted.
